GASS is a gospel-singing group of four friends who sing and play to share Jesus through music. They met as members of a church worship team and in 2015 had the opportunity to take their talent on the road. Gospel songs comprise most of the repertoire, along with an occasional secular song. Styles include southern gospel, contemporary worship, country and rockabilly.

The group name GASS comes from the first letters of their names: Greg Smyer, vocals and guitar; Andy Colclasure, vocals, bass guitar and drums; Stan Boggs, vocals and guitar; and Susie Knickerbocker, vocals and keyboard. They make their homes in Kansas and Oklahoma.

GASS has been privileged to play venues in Kansas and Oklahoma for worship services in several denominations, picnics, fundraisers, nursing homes, the Cowley County fair, community concerts, cowboy church, special needs horse camp, Valentine’s Day dinner, RV clubs, and Ponca City Gospel Jubilee. They have twice shared billing at a community concert with well-known cowboy-song writer Barry Ward.

Their first CD, the self-titled GASS, was released in 2016. GASS is pleased to announce the release of their second CD, Prairie Praise, in 2018.
